In modern teeth whitening systems, safety is closely tied to how light-based technologies are applied. The choice of LED Wavelength plays a critical role in determining whether a whitening solution can be considered truly Enamel Safe. For B2B manufacturers and OEM partners, understanding the relationship between wavelength selection, material interaction, and enamel protection is essential for developing safe and effective products.
Different LED Wavelength ranges interact with dental tissues in distinct ways. Selecting an appropriate wavelength allows effective activation of whitening agents while minimizing direct impact on enamel structure, supporting Enamel Safe performance.
An unsuitable LED Wavelength can generate excessive heat or unwanted photochemical reactions. Proper wavelength selection reduces these risks, helping ensure whitening treatments remain Enamel Safe during repeated use.
The effectiveness of whitening relies on precise activation rather than higher intensity. A targeted LED Wavelength enables efficient gel activation without overexposing enamel, reinforcing Enamel Safe system design.
Whitening systems designed around specific LED Wavelength parameters can work effectively with gentler formulations. This compatibility helps reduce enamel stress and supports Enamel Safe product positioning.
Enamel safety must demonstrated through testing and validation. Using a well-defined Wavelength simplifies safety assessments and supports Enamel Safe claims in product documentation.
For OEM brands, emphasizing controlled Wavelength selection signals a commitment to safety. Products designed with Enamel Safe principles gain stronger trust and credibility in competitive whitening markets.
The specific Wavelength is a key factor in achieving truly Enamel Safe whitening solutions. By carefully selecting and validating wavelength parameters, B2B manufacturers and OEM partners can balance whitening effectiveness with enamel protection, delivering safer and more reliable products.
